Output 5086d64c8ab9d78d970d1271f6ff92c4e2ca7ec82fbb11a5e91ca04a43e553bb:1

value
509343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7e63083dd24fb502a6a799c7bd3137c7d5292ef OP_EQUAL
address
3Kuz9ZmG5zrQ6z5oF1XdBwydkvvnTVaqgJ
transaction
5086d64c8ab9d78d970d1271f6ff92c4e2ca7ec82fbb11a5e91ca04a43e553bb
confirmations
31085
spent
true